Lara believes Prithvi Shaw can break his 400* record

Recently, David Warner came close to beat Lara’s record but Tim Paine decided to declare when Warner was batting at 335* against Pakistan in the recently concluded Test series.

Talking about the record, Lara named two cricketers who can break it.

“A guy like Rohit Sharma who you know you wonder if he’s still a Test cricketer or not. If he gets going on a good day, on his day, on a good pitch, right situation he can do it. It will need an attacking option. I know he’s fell off the radar a little bit, Prithvi Shaw was one of those attacking options. Hey, here’s a 19-year-old who has the world in front of him, hopefully, he can come back soon.”

David Warner himself backed Rohit Sharma to break the record. However, Prithvi Shaw’s name is a surprise considering the youngster is just two-Tests old.
